Higher Psychology: Approaches & Methods by Gerard Keegan ISBN: 0340850280 Publisher: Hodder & Stoughton 30/8/2002

You can get your copy here


Tailored to the curriculum of the Scottish Qualifications Authority, Higher Psychology: Approaches & Methods aims to develop the ability in readers to understand and explain the main theoretical approaches and research methods in psychology, and to interpret, analyse and critically evaluate, theories, evidence and methods.

It is being used extensively by students of Intermediate, Higher and Advanced Higher psychology in Scotland, and has been described as 'crucial' for the teaching of AS/A level psychology in England and Wales. Recently found relevant to psychology in the International Baccalaureate, it is also appreciated by those doing Scotland's Higher National Psychology Units, or anyone new to psychology at university level in the English-speaking world.

It contains extra features for learning, including structured assessment questions, interactive activities, links to online teaching and learning exercises, as well as end of chapter summaries for revision.
